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ature Request] Add a mode for "speedbar". #12

Open
shamefulCake1 opened this issue Feb 18, 2024 · 2 comments
Open

[Feature Request] Add a mode for "speedbar". #12

shamefulCake1 opened this issue Feb 18, 2024 · 2 comments

Comments

@shamefulCake1
Copy link

May I ask that mu4e-overview supply a "speedbar minor mode" wrapping it?

Seemingly the data model would map very well to the tree widged "supported" by speedbar, and although speedbar is not the best example of code, it is shipped with Emacs, and can be exploited.

There already is a prototype of the code in the stock mu4e, called mu4e-speedbar, but it is also not a "speedbar mode".

https://github.com/djcb/mu/blob/master/mu4e/mu4e-speedbar.el

@mkcms
Copy link
Owner

mkcms commented Feb 19, 2024

Thanks for the feature request.

I don't use speedbar myself, but I will try it out and see if it can be extended to support our mu4e hierarchy.
At the very least, I could provide a more higher-level function that yields our maildir hierarchy, to make it easier to write your own speedbar wrapper.

I will look into speedbar to see if this makes sense.

@mkcms
Copy link
Owner

mkcms commented May 21, 2024

I just pushed 673fe69 which adds a public function to get the folder hierarchy and the total/unread counts. That makes it possible for users to implement alternative views for the hierarchy. I still haven't delved into speedbar though.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ants